University of Houston: Engines of Our Ingenuity: No. 702: Trompe L'oeil

Curated by ACT

A short lecture on trompe l'oeil in art that introduces the concept of realism turned to visual deception in artwork. It explores the great divide in theory between Plato and Aristotle which serves as an epistemological backdrop to the Renaissance. This is a transcript of an accompanying radio broadcast.
